In July 2023, Amelia was diagnosed with Very Early Onset Inflammatory Bowel Disease (VEO-IBD), which is a a rare form of IBD, only diagnosed in 15% of pediatric patients. We have been in and out of inpatient hospital stays since July. She has had 3 blood transfusions, countless iron infusions, bi-weekly rounds of Remicaide infusions, nightly doses of steroids (to help bridge the gap in between infusions), iron supplements and more tests and bloodwork than I can even count. Despite our best efforts, Amelia continues to have flare-ups, which cause mucusy, bloody and wet diarrhea, VERY intense stomach pain, dehydration, extreme fatigue, loss of appetite and hospitalization.
Amelia was recently admitted into the VEO-IBD clinic at CHOP, for genetic testing, nutritional guidance and (unfortunately) more testing, which includes more CT scans, MRI's and colonoscopies, her first appointment is scheduled for January 4, 2024. This clinic appears to be her best shot at living a normal life and helping us navigate this disease to help our baby live pain free. In order to be seen at CHOP, we need to travel back and forth to Philadelphia, staying in hotels while we see the doctors and get the testing done. With two other kids in school, traveling and hospital bills adding up quickly (as of now over 130k owed to HUMC, after insurance), I am kindly asking for some assistance so we are able to bring her to CHOP for these very important tests to help her have a better, pain free life. "Very Early Onset Inflammatory Bowel Disease (VEO-IBD), defined as disease in children less than 6 years of age, is often a severe and debilitating form of IBD with distinct characteristics (overlapping frequently with immune deficiencies and other rare/orphan diseases). These children often fail to respond to conventional therapies or surgery."
